Comprehending Different Roof Materials
When selecting roof products, which choices are most suitable for a given climate and framework? Various roof products supply unique benefits and negative aspects, making the selection important for toughness and efficiency. Asphalt tiles are popular for their price and flexibility, appropriate for a variety of climates. Steel roof covering, renowned for its longevity and energy effectiveness, stands out in locations with hefty rainfall or snow, as it sheds water efficiently. Clay and concrete tiles supply excellent insulation and endure extreme temperatures, making them optimal for warm, deserts. Nevertheless, their weight requires durable architectural assistance. For eco-conscious property owners, green roofing systems or solar ceramic tiles present lasting choices that additionally enhance power effectiveness. Ultimately, the best roof covering product relies on regional climate patterns, architectural style, and personal choices, ensuring that the picked choice straightens well with both functional and visual requirements.

Thinking About Power Performance Includes
What variables should house owners take into consideration when evaluating the power effectiveness attributes of roof covering alternatives? They need to take a look at the product's insulation homes. Roof coverings with high thermal resistance (R-value) help keep indoor temperature levels, reducing home heating and air conditioning prices. Reflective roof materials, often identified as "awesome roof coverings," can reduce warm absorption, significantly decreasing power intake throughout hot months.Additionally, home owners need to think about the roofing's air flow system. Correct ventilation not only stops wetness accumulation but likewise advertises energy effectiveness by regulating indoor temperature levels. The choice of color additionally plays a role; lighter colors reflect sunshine, adding to reduced energy usage.Finally, house owners need to evaluate the life-span and toughness of the roof covering material, as longer-lasting options can add to total power savings over time. Examining these power efficiency features warranties that home owners spend in roof remedies that line up with their sustainability goals and monetary savings.
Reviewing Local Building Codes and Laws
Energy performance features are read review simply one element of roof covering choices; house owners have to additionally browse regional building regulations and laws. These codes are developed to guarantee safety and security, architectural stability, and conformity with neighborhood standards. Each jurisdiction may have details needs relating to materials, installation approaches, and layout aspects. Some locations may mandate the use of fireproof products or determine the incline of roofs to manage water drain effectively.Homeowners need to speak with neighborhood authorities or building divisions to understand these policies before proceeding with roofing jobs. Falling short to comply with these codes can cause expensive penalties, delays, or the demand for rework. Furthermore, collaborating with a professional roofer accustomed to neighborhood laws can improve the process, assuring that all aspects of the job meet lawful requirements. Ultimately, complete study right into regional building ordinance is vital for a certified and successful roof solution.

What Are the Indications of Roof Damage?
Indicators of roofing damages consist of missing shingles, water stains on ceilings, drooping locations, mold growth, and granules in rain gutters. Home owners need to on a regular basis evaluate roof coverings to determine these concerns early and protect against more wear and tear.
